1.1、硬件配置
操作系统:http://isoredirect.centos.org/centos/7/isos/x86_64/CentOS-7-x86_64-DVD-1708.iso
控制节点: cpu 1 ,内存 3G,网卡 2张,存储 30G
计算节点: cpu 1 ,内存 1G,网卡 2张,存储 30G
1.2、ip地址大家根据自己实际情况而定
控制节点第一张网卡:10.0.0.11
控制节点第二张网卡:
计算节点第一张网卡:10.0.0.31
计算几点第二张网卡:
1.3、 修改主机名,并添加hosts映射
编辑文件/etc/hosts,删除原有内容,然后添加自己的主机名
hostnamectl set-hostname controller
10.0.0.11 controller
10.0.0.31 computer1
1.4、 关闭防火墙
systemctl disable firewalld
systemctl stop firewalld
禁用selinux,避免踩坑!编辑/etc/selinux/config,将enforcing修改为disabled。
SELINUX=disabled
selinux的设置需要重启节点才能生效。
setenforce 0 临时修改,马上生效
1.5、准备yum本地源
上传如下文件至/root目录下,并解压onehost.tar.gz文件。
mkdir /opt/openstack mount /root/openstack_queens.iso /mnt cp /mnt/* /opt/openstack/ tar -xvf /root/onehost.tar.gz cp -r /root/onehost/repodata /opt/openstack/ mkdir /etc/yum.repos.d/bak mv /etc/yum.repos.d/* /etc/yum.repos.d/bak/
cp /root/onehost/local.repo /etc/yum.repos.d/
二、OpenStack基础环境安装
1.1、控制节点和计算节点都安装ntp服务
yum install chrony -y
1.2、编辑配置文件/etc/chrony.conf增加以下内容
控制节点:
server ntp6.aliyun.com iburst
allow 10.0.0.0/24 #这个根据自己子网情况
计算节点:
server 10.0.0.11 iburst
设置服务的开机启动,并启动服务:
systemctl enable chronyd
systemctl start chronyd
1.3、(控制节点、计算节点)升级软件包,安装OpenStack客户端
yum upgrade 升级软件包
yum install python-openstackclient -y 安装OpenStack客户端
yum install openstack-selinux -y 安装openstack-selinux
Centos7.4安装openstack(queens)详细安装部署(一)---基础环境安装
原文:https://www.cnblogs.com/aqicheng/p/13307073.html